Energy Erectors, Inc. (EEI) tackles terrain, technology, and timelines to construct transmission line projects up to 500 kV and has over 30 years of experience building substations and switchyards. With integrated in-house construction, engineering, procurement, and commissioning capabilities, Energy Erectors has the experience and resources to deliver world-class solutions to complex power transmission and distribution projects. Areas of expertise include GIS and VAR compensators. EEI's mission is to safely deliver the highest quality work, exceed client expectations, and relentlessly maintain a reputation for integrity.

Job Summary

The Training Specialist position is responsible for delivering both the classroom and field instructions for the DOL approved MasTec Transmission Apprentice Program. This role also includes delivering New Hire Orientations and teaching essential courses like the OSHA-10 ETD, OSHA-20 HR, First Aid/CPR, Equipment Training, and other courses applicable to Transmission Construction. This trainer will use T&D PowerSkills and UKG lesson curriculum to ensure apprentices fulfill their mandatory classroom training. This position will require travel to jobsites as necessary for in-person, virtual training, and E-Learning.

Physical Demands and Work Environment

This job operates in a field environment. This role routinely requires extended periods of bending, squatting, climbing, kneeling, pushing, pulling, lifting, lifting in awkward positions, standing, and twisting. Also, working in inclement weather conditions, such as extreme heat, extreme cold, rain, ice, snow, and wind.

The physical demands described here are representative of those that must be met by an employee to successfully perform the essential functions of the job. This position is physically active, with lifting required. Must be able to bend and lift and carry up to 50 pounds. Clarity of vision at 20 feet or more or 20 inches or less, with the ability to judge distance and space relationships. Precise hand-eye coordination. Ability to identify and distinguish colors.
